Name |
Mode of Action |
References |
Actinomycin D |
Inhibits cell proliferation by forming complex with DNA and blocks production of mRNA (RNA polymerase inhibition); Induces apoptosis. |
[55] |
Daunorubicin |
Complexes to DNA and blocks production of mRNA by RNA polymerase. |
[56] |
Doxorubicin |
Inhibits reverse transcriptase and RNA polymerase by binding to DNA. |
[57] |
Homoharringtonine |
Binds to the 80S ribosome in eukaryotic cells and inhibits protein synthesis by interfering with chain elongation. |
[58] |
Idarubicin |
Antileukemia agent with higher DNA binding capacity and greater cytotoxicity than daunorubicin |
